About the Role As Home Manager, you’ll have full operational and clinical responsibility for the day-to-day running of the home, ensuring the highest standards of care, compliance, and resident satisfaction. You will lead a dedicated team of nurses and carers, promote a positive workplace culture, and ensure the home continues to deliver excellent outcomes in line with CQC and company standards. Responsibilities: * Lead, inspire, and manage your team to deliver outstanding person-centred care. * Maintain compliance with all CQC regulations and company quality standards. * Oversee budgeting, occupancy, staffing, and financial performance. * Build strong relationships with residents, families, staff, and external stakeholders. * Drive continuous improvement and excellence in care delivery. Qualifications: * Registered Nurse (RGN/RMN/RNLD) with active NMC PIN. * Previous experience as a Home Manager or strong Deputy Manager ready to step up. * Excellent understanding of CQC requirements and clinical governance. *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ills. * A compassionate, professional, and proactive approach to care management.
